Eternal Limited (ETERNAL) — Net Asset Quality Index
Eternal Limited (ETERNAL)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 80.8% as of September 2025.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of Rs381.15 Billion minus total liabilities of Rs73.00 Billion yields net assets of Rs308.15 Billion. A higher index indicates a stronger, lower-leverage balance sheet. Read ETERNAL total debt and obligations for a breakdown of total debt and financial obligations.

Annual Net Asset Quality Index for Eternal Limited (2019–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Net Asset Quality Index for Eternal Limited from 2019 to 2025, covering 7 annual filings. Each row shows total assets, total liabilities, net assets, the quality index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| Quality Index | Net Assets (INR) | Total Assets | Total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 85.1% | Rs303.10 Billion | Rs356.23 Billion | Rs53.13 Billion | ▼ -2.3 pp |
| 2024 | 87.4% | Rs204.06 Billion | Rs233.56 Billion | Rs29.50 Billion | ▼ -2.7 pp |
| 2023 | 90.1% | Rs194.53 Billion | Rs215.99 Billion | Rs21.46 Billion | ▼ -5.2 pp |
| 2022 | 95.2% | Rs164.99 Billion | Rs173.27 Billion | Rs8.28 Billion | ▲ +2.2 pp |
| 2021 | 93.0% | Rs80.93 Billion | Rs87.03 Billion | Rs6.11 Billion | ▲ +68.7 pp |
| 2020 | 24.2% | Rs7.03 Billion | Rs29.00 Billion | Rs21.97 Billion | ▼ -51.0 pp |
| 2019 | 75.2% | Rs25.68 Billion | Rs34.13 Billion | Rs8.45 Billion | — |
